.. _V6.02.143: **v6.02.143** SSNL143 — Validation of the relaxation law for pre-stressed steel cables =============================================================================================== **Summary:** The objective of this test is to validate the law of relaxation behavior of steel cables used in pre-stressed concrete. The validation is carried out against the expressions from BPEL. Three models are carried out: • a) Simulation of cable relaxation (class 1, :math:`k1=6.0E-03`, :math:`k2=1.10`) (class 1,,), over a period of 4000 hours, with :math:`\mathrm{\mu }=0.75`. • b) Simulation of cable relaxation (class 2, :math:`k1=8.0E-03`, :math:`k2=1.25`), over a period of 4000 hours, with :math:`\mathrm{\mu }=0.75`. • c) Simulation of a relaxation with variable deformation of a cable over a period of 6 years.
